What Are Agro Drones? An In-Depth Overview

Agro drones are specialized Unmanned Aerial Vehicles (UAVs) designed specifically for agricultural applications. Unlike recreational or commercial drones used for photography or surveillance, agro drones are equipped with agricultural sensors, multispectral cameras, and advanced imaging technologies that provide detailed insights into crop health, soil condition, and pest infestations.

These drones can perform a variety of tasks, including:

  • Crop Monitoring: Providing high-resolution images to detect diseases, nutrient deficiencies, and pest issues early.
  • Precision Spraying: Targeting specific areas with pesticides, herbicides, or fertilizers, significantly reducing chemical usage and environmental impact.
  • Soil Analysis: Collecting data on soil moisture, compaction, and quality to inform irrigation and fertilization strategies.
  • Field Mapping and Planning: Creating accurate maps that assist in efficient land use and resource allocation.

Key Technologies Empowering Agro Drones

The effectiveness of agro drones hinges on a convergence of innovative technologies:

  • Multispectral and Hyperspectral Cameras: Capture data across various spectra, enabling detection of plant stress, disease, and nutrient deficiencies that are invisible to the naked eye.
  • GPS and RTK Positioning: Ensure precise flight paths for targeted interventions and accurate mapping.
  • AI and Machine Learning: Analyze collected data to identify patterns, predict crop yields, and suggest actionable insights.
  • Autonomous Navigation Systems: Allow drones to operate independently over large fields, minimizing human intervention.
  • Advanced Spraying Systems: Enable variable-rate pesticide and fertilizer application, optimizing resource use.

Advantages of Integrating Agro Drones into Modern Farming

The adoption of agro drones introduces a multitude of benefits that collectively foster sustainable, productive, and profitable agricultural practices:

Enhanced Crop Monitoring and Disease Detection

Agro drones provide farmers with high-frequency, real-time imagery allowing for early detection of diseases, pest outbreaks, and nutrient deficiencies. This proactive approach minimizes crop losses and reduces the need for blanket chemical applications.

Increased Precision and Resource Efficiency

Targeted spraying and irrigation reduce the consumption of water, fertilizers, and chemicals. This not only diminishes environmental impact but also lowers operational costs, directly impacting the bottom line of farming enterprises.

Time and Labor Savings

Automated flight routines and data analysis reduce the labor intensity of crop monitoring. Drones can cover vast fields swiftly, significantly cutting down on manual labor hours.

Data-Driven Decision Making

Combining drone-collected data with geographic information systems (GIS) and AI tools yields comprehensive insights that inform planting schedules, crop management, and harvest planning.

Environmental Sustainability

Precision agriculture facilitated by agro drones promotes minimal chemical runoff, optimized water use, and a reduction in soil disturbance—contributing positively to ecological preservation.

Implementing Agro Drones: Strategies for Success

Transitioning to drone-assisted farming requires strategic planning and adherence to best practices:

  • Assessing Infrastructure Needs: Ensure sufficient power supply, internet connectivity, and storage solutions for drone data.
  • Selecting the Right Equipment: Choose drones with suitable payload capacities, flight time, and sensor options tailored to specific crop types and farm sizes.
  • Staff Training and Skill Development: Invest in training operators to ensure safe and effective drone operations.
  • Compliance with Regulations: Stay informed about aviation and data privacy laws governing drone usage in your region.
  • Integrating Data Management Systems: Use robust software platforms to analyze, visualize, and act on collected data efficiently.

The Future of Agro Drones and Precision Agriculture

As technology continues to evolve, the role of agro drones will become even more integral to sustainable agriculture. Emerging advancements include:

  • Swarm Drone Systems: Coordinated fleets operating simultaneously for large-scale monitoring and spraying.
  • Enhanced AI Algorithms: Improving predictive analytics for weather, pest outbreaks, and crop yields.
  • Solar-Powered Drones: Extending flight durations and reducing operational costs.
  • Integration with IoT Devices: Connecting drone data with ground sensors for comprehensive farm management.
